Rose, a theater teen and amateur mystic, is in for another normal year of classes, stage productions, and secret Tarot readings. When she and her friends meet Leah, the group quickly form a bond, welcoming her into their ranks. But that bond is shaken when Rose suggests communicating with a spirit in the old theater on Halloween night, and a fearful Leah objects. Undeterred, Rose and the others perform the ritual, and soon regret it. Strange things begin happening around the theater, endangering the upcoming performance. Worse, Leah becomes more and more withdrawn, refusing to communicate with anyone. Determined to help their tormented friend, Rose and the others begin to probe for information. Just what did Rose call up? What does it have to do with Leah's depression? The answers may lie in their town's sordid history, of which few living people have any knowledge. But how much are the dead willing to say?
